Harley Quinn showrunners Justin Halpern and Patrick Schumacker have a spinoff animated series coming to HBO Max with a working title of Noonan’s. The show is named after the dive bar in the DC animated universe and centers on Kite Man (voiced by Matt Oberg), Poison Ivy’s former boyfriend.

The news comes just before the Harley Quinn series returns for its third season this summer. We don’t know much more about the new series, however, other than its working title, that it will be ten episodes long, and the following logline:

Lovable loser Kite Man and his new squeeze Golden Glider moonlight as criminals to support their foolish purchase of Noonan’s, Gotham’s seediest dive bar, where everybody knows your name, but not necessarily your secret identity!

We also know that the execs at Warner Bros. and HBO Max are super stoked about it.

“We love the wild and fun world of Harley Quinn so much we just had to make a spinoff and who better to center it around than the outcast Kite Man. Justin, Patrick, and Dean have created the perfect local hangout for Gotham City’s not-so-finest at Noonan’s, where bar patrons can blow off steam after a long day of mayhem,” Suzanna Makkos, EVP of Original Comedy and Adult Animation at HBO Max and Adult Swim, said in a statement.

Not to be outdone, Peter Girardi, EVP of Alternative Programming at Warner Bros. Animation, also had great things to say about the project. “Harley Quinn unlocked a world of hilarious possibilities with the iconic superheroes and supervillains of the DC Universe. Exploring this world further with our partners at HBO Max and DC is going to be a lot of fun,” he said. “Plus, after getting dumped by Poison Ivy, the least we could do was give Kite Man his own show.”

No news yet on when Noonan’s will make its way to the streaming platform.
